Idiot’s Array is a Star Wars podcast hosted by Alan Zaugg, Mark Sutter, and Ryder Waldron. We bridge the Star Wars galaxy, from the movies to the comics, the novels to Star Wars Rebels and The Clone Wars. On Idiot’s Array we discuss Star Wars in a fun and intelligent way. Anakin Skywalker and Luke Skywalker experienced love in very different ways during their childhoods. As a young child, Anakin felt genuine love from his mother Shmi, but when he reached the Jedi Temple he didn't feel that same love from the adults around him. Luke was raised by a loving (and sometimes stern) aunt and uncle, and then felt loved and valued by the new friends he met later on. How did the ways they were loved influence Anakin's and Luke's destinies? We take a deep dive on Episode 229. We begin the show by discussing the new trailer for Skeleton Crew. The calvary has arrived and we are here to wrap up The Bad Batch. Join us as we breakdown the season 3/series finale. -Crosshair wants to take on the Imperial troops alone. -Emerie and Echo team up. -Omega escapes with the other children and frees the Zillo Beast. -Omega and Echo free the other Clones. -Echo recruits some of the freed Clones to help him complete the mission. -Rampart hasn't changed and meets his justly demise. -Hemlock captures Omega and Crosshair's shot helps free her. -Return to Pabu. -In the epilogue, Hunter is finally able to let Omega go.
